Small Business Insurance You Can Count On
That's because a small business policy from State Farm covers a wide range of concerns. Your coverage can include a business owners policy that provides for loss of income (for up to 12 months) in the event your business is closed down. It not only protects your compensation, but also helps with regular payroll costs. You can also include liability, which is vital coverage protecting your business in the event of a claim or judgment against you by a visitor.
